One of the first works I read on freethought. It made a big impression on me, challenging things I had accepted most of my life, and led me to read more works on the topic. The author writes in a sharp, sassy style that brightens up a difficult and often dreary subject.
The first half of this book , dealing with religion and the bible, is very good, but I found the biographical sketches in the latter half of the book to drag. I'm not sure why, as they were written in the same easy prose as the first of the book; perhaps it's difficult for some of us to credit all the wonderful childhood memories of someone who appeared to have few serious traumas.
An essential read, in my opinion, for anyone looking for info on Christianity. Definitely a skewed viewpoint, but what would you expect, given the title. I'd give this a five, based on the info it provides, but it is poorly organized, many, many examples restated many times throughout the book.
